About the role

The successful candidate will play a hands-on role in developing institutional investment solutions and producing high-quality client deliverables that effectively communicate Hillsdale's research, capabilities, and investment process.

Responsibilities

  • Partner directly with portfolio managers and researchers to transform cutting-edge quantitative research into institutional investment solutions and to effectively communicate the value of Hillsdale’s investment process to clients and prospects.
  • Publish research-driven thought leadership that enhances Hillsdale's brand and market positioning.
  • Craft compelling new business presentations that articulate the benefits and differentiating features of Hillsdale’s investment process.
  • Create tailored investment content and institutional deliverables that support client engagement and broader business development initiatives.
  • Leverage Hillsdale’s RFP machine to compose compelling RFP submissions that showcase Hillsdale’s capabilities and increase Hillsdale’s probability of success in searches.
  • Participate in client and prospect meetings advancing your skills and understanding of institutional investment requirements.
  • Contribute to the design, enhancement, and production of all institutional deliverables.
  • Ensure that all client communications are aligned with the principles of excellence embedded in Hillsdale’s Best Practices.

Requirements

  • 3–5+ years of experience developing sophisticated institutional investment analysis, communications, and deliverables, including experience in institutional investing in Canada and/or the U.S., gained at a leading asset manager, asset owner, investment consultant, OCIO, investment bank, or similar institution.
  • A strong understanding of quantitative investing, statistics, and capital markets.
  • Proficiency in Python, Excel, and PowerPoint.
  • Exceptional analytical and critical-thinking skills, with the ability to understand, synthesize, and communicate complex investment concepts.
  • Excellent organizational skills and the ability to manage multiple priorities while delivering high-quality work in a fast-paced, intellectually rigorous environment.
  • An entrepreneurial, results-oriented mindset, with a commitment to continuous learning and professional development.

Qualifications

  • This multifaceted and dynamic role requires a strong foundation in quantitative investing, institutional communications and presentations, statistical analysis, and Python.
  • You are intellectually curious, proactive, and committed to continuous learning, with a demonstrated ability to incorporate feedback and guidance effectively.
  • You have a Bachelor of Commerce (B.Com.) or equivalent degree and a CFA Charter.
  • Residence in Canada is required.
  • Bilingualism (English/French) is an asset.
